はじめに
こんにちは、皆さん。今日はプログラミングの世界についてお話ししましょう。プログラミングは、問題解決のための素晴らしいツールです。しかし、それ自体が問題を引き起こすこともあります。それらの問題とその解決策について、一緒に考えてみましょう。一般的なプログラミングの問題
プログラミングには、一般的に以下のような問題があります。 1. バグ:これはプログラムが意図した通りに動作しない状態を指します。バグは、プログラムのロジックエラーや、予期しない入力によって引き起こされます。 2. パフォーマンス:プログラムが遅い、またはリソースを大量に消費する場合、これはパフォーマンスの問題です。これは、効率的でないアルゴリズムや、不適切なデータ構造によって引き起こされます。 3. セキュリティ:プログラムが攻撃者による攻撃に対して脆弱である場合、これはセキュリティの問題です。これは、不適切な入力検証や、古いライブラリの使用によって引き起こされます。これらの問題の解決策
これらの問題を解決するためには、以下のようなアプローチがあります。 1. バグ:バグを解決するためには、まずそのバグを再現できるテストケースを作成します。次に、デバッガを使用して問題の原因を特定し、それを修正します。 2. パフォーマンス:パフォーマンスの問題を解決するためには、まずその問題を特定するためのプロファイリングを行います。次に、アルゴリズムを改善したり、適切なデータ構造を選択したりします。 3. セキュリティ:セキュリティの問題を解決するためには、まずその問題を特定するためのセキュリティ監査を行います。次に、入力検証を強化したり、最新のライブラリを使用したりします。まとめ
プログラミングは、問題解決のための素晴らしいツールですが、それ自体が問題を引き起こすこともあります。しかし、それらの問題は、適切なアプローチとツールを使用すれば解決できます。プログラミングの世界は、常に新しい問題とその解決策を提供してくれます。それがプログラミングの魅力の一つですね。 それでは、次回もお楽しみに。この記事はきりんツールのAI機能を活用して作成されました
コメント